Rabies is a viral disease of mammals that invades the central nervous system, causing headache, anxiety ... WebRabies is an infection affecting the central nervous system, or brain and spinal cord, of humans and animals. This infection is caused by a virus that is transmitted primarily from bite wounds, scratches, or tissue from an infected animal. It is nearly always deadly if not treated before the beginning of symptoms.

In case you didn’t know, rabies is a viral infection that can spread from ... WebMost pets get rabies from having contact with wildlife. Because of laws requiring dogs to be vaccinated for rabies in the United States, dogs make up only about 1% of rabid animals reported each year in this country. However, dog rabies remains common in many countries. Exposure to rabid dogs is still the cause of nearly all human rabies deaths ...

WebIf the owner is unwilling to have the animal euthanized, the animal should be placed in strict quarantine for 4 (dogs and cats) or 6 (ferrets) months. A rabies vaccine should be administered at the time of entry into quarantine.
